摘要:
Triplet states of oligothiophenes and C-60 were excited by a pulsed laser light using a Nd:YAG laser. The finestructure values D, E of different endcapped oligothiophenes (EC3T, EC4T, and EC5T) were determined from pulsed EPR-spectra. Time resolution was applied to study the kinetics and relaxation times. A photoinduced electron transfer from EC4T to C-60 in liquid solutions was investigated in detail. Fourier transform of the free induction decays results in spectra of the transient triplet state and of the transient C-60 monoradical anion. Electron transfer rates were deduced from the observed triplet quenching rates at different temperatures.
